Germany boosted by return of Lehmann

JENS LEHMANN is set to start for Germany against Wales on Saturday after coming through yesterday’s training session unscathed.

The Arsenal keeper has not played since Germany’s friendly victory against England on August 22 due to an elbow injury.

The setback continued a poor start to the season for the 37-year-old, who made errors in the Gunners’ Premier League games against Fulham and Blackburn.
